I have almost all my parts together for my Koni/RS*R race spring combo. Who else has Koni's on their S13? I understand how the fronts install, but what is it that you do to the rears besides the bolt in part? I read somewhere that you are supposed to take the spring collar off of the stock strut and put it on the Koni.

The rears are just a remove and replace. Koni provides good instructions for the install. I had those springs and shocks on my 240. The fronts should be shortened as stock length koni's and those springs will leave very little travel. You can try it if you want first.
